Mini DevCamp + Appshare

Guest presenter: Renowned Blackberry Architect Steve Boyle helped lead Citibanks global mobile applications strategy. Steve will share his experiences with the RIM platform and where he thinks things are headed for the future.

Appshare: We had a very successful Appshare session at the last Meetup and actually used it as an opportunity to Alpha test for the upcoming Disruptathon in October. We featured nine presenters who each had five minutes to sell their innovations. We used Zerion Softwares (Sze Wong) ExZact lite realtime voting app to determine the winning presenter. We also put to great use Point Abouts (Scott Suhy, Daniel Odio, Isaac Mosquera) iPhone to Projector device. The winning presenter was Samir Roy who developed Classics2Go, an app that features a unique reader and 50 classic books. Nice job, Samir!
